I need a new company logo, one that is simple, professional, easily recognizable and one that will provide an identity. The logo will be used in color and black & white. Some green in it would be good and perhaps mountains. We are a wilderness medical education company. It is a side job that has been growing. We are located in Estes Park, Colorado next to Rocky Mountain National Park. We teach wilderness medicine to Search and Rescue groups, Park rangers, rock and ice climbers, cyclists, paddlers, climbing guides and will be starting dive medicine next year. We run classes internationally. Some of our students guide on K2 and Everest. Most students need our courses for their employment and are outdoor professionals.

The company name is Trailmed Wilderness Medicine. I would like to see " Medical training" or "Medical training for outdoor professionals" somewhere in the logo too. Please do not let me curb your creativity though. Let's see what you got.

This logo will be used for all promotions, t-shirts and web site. If this works out I would be willing to pay for design of cards, shirts and other things.


***I am running a seperate contest for a company patch as well for $50.*** Enter both if you wish.


I am looking for a design for a company patch. Preferably round or square. It will be given to students on completion of courses and for all of our instructors. Please use the above information. It should not say 'wilderness medical education' on it though. One idea that I liked was the serpant around the climbing ax in a standard medical configuration.
